Career path

Job Title Description
Business Continuity Manager Responsible for developing and implementing business continuity plans for vendors and suppliers to ensure uninterrupted operations during disruptions.
Risk Management Specialist Identify and assess potential risks to vendors and suppliers' operations and develop strategies to mitigate these risks.
Supply Chain Analyst Analyze supply chain processes and identify areas for improvement to enhance resilience and continuity for vendors and suppliers.
Vendor Relationship Manager Manage relationships with vendors and suppliers to ensure alignment with business continuity plans and maintain continuity of supply.
Compliance Officer Ensure vendors and suppliers comply with regulatory requirements related to business continuity and implement necessary measures to address any gaps.
